Bowen Yang Leaving SNL? Fans Speculate After Season 50 Finale

Speculation is running rampant among fans of “Saturday Night Live” following the season 50 finale, as many believe that cast member Bowen Yang may be leaving the show. The 34-year-old comedian appeared visibly emotional during the closing ‘Goodnights’ segment on Saturday, May 17, hugging his fellow castmates before the network feed cut away for a commercial break. This led to fans questioning whether Yang’s hugs were farewell gestures, fueling rumors of his potential departure.

One fan on social media expressed, “If Bowen is leaving I won’t be shocked,” while another asked, “Um, is Bowen also leaving?????” The emotional display by Yang during the finale has left many viewers wondering about his future on the show. Another fan admitted, “If Bowen’s actually leaving idk how to feel… it would be an appropriate time if he wants to pursue other things.”

Yang’s prominent presence in the season finale sketches, including a sequel to the popular “Bowen’s Straight” sketch, further added to the speculation of his potential exit. In an interview with People back in April, Yang hinted at the possibility of leaving “Saturday Night Live” at some point, mentioning that he had started envisioning his career beyond the show.

While no official exits were confirmed during the finale, rumors had been circulating prior to the episode about possible departures from the show. “Weekend Update” co-anchor Michael Che had previously joked about leaving the show during a standup comedy performance, and Heidi Gardner and Mikey Day also hinted at potential changes in their future plans.

In the recent season 50 finale, Scarlett Johansson had the opportunity to get her revenge on her husband, Colin Jost’s “Weekend Update” co-anchor, Michael Che. Che had previously joked about Johansson’s private parts, comparing them to roast beef in a December 2024 episode. Johansson took the opportunity to playfully get back at Che during the finale, adding a humorous twist to the show.

The finale also featured a heartwarming moment when Jost surprised Johansson on stage during the “Goodnights” segment. He presented her with a bouquet of flowers and shared a sweet kiss, showing their love and support for each other.
